Local Name: Kulantro/ Unsoy

English Name: Coriander/ Cilantro


Scientific Name: Coriandrum Sativum

Uses and Benefits:


 Coriander seeds, extract, and oils may all help lower blood sugar.
 Coriander contains antimicrobial compounds that may help fight certain infections
and foodborne illnesses.
 Oil extracted from coriander seeds may accelerate and promote healthy digestion.
Coriander Extract is used as an appetite stimulant in traditional Iranian medicine.
 Coriander offers several antioxidants, which prevent cellular damage caused by free
radicals. These compounds include terpinene, quercetin, and tocopherols, which may
have anticancer, immune-boosting, and neuroprotective effects, according to test-tube
and animal studies.
 Coriander may lower heart disease risk factors, such as high blood pressure and LDL
(bad) cholesterol levels.

Local Name: Tim
English Name: Thyme
Scientific Name: Thymus Vulgaris

Uses and Benefits:


 Thyme is known for its antibacterial properties, and it might have a future as an acne-
fighting ingredient.
 Thyme is packed with helpful nutrients, including: vitamin A, vitamin C, copper, fiber,
iron and manganese.
 Thyme essential oil, which is obtained from its leaves, is often used as a natural cough
remedy.
 Thyme essential oil is often used for aromatic and therapeutic purposes because of its
active substance, carvacrol. Carvacrol was shown to increase concentrations
of serotonin and dopamine, two hormones that regulate mood.
 Thymus linearis Benth. is a species of thyme found in Pakistan and Afghanistan. In
a 2014 study, they found that an extract was able to significantly lower heart rate in rats
with high blood pressure. It was also able to lower their cholesterol. Not tested in
humans yet, however.

Local Name: Perehil


English Name: Parsley
Scientific Name: Petroselinum Crispum
Uses and Benefits:
 Parsley has been used to treat conditions like high blood pressure, allergies, and
inflammatory diseases.
 Parsley is packed with vitamin K — an essential nutrient for bone health.
 Parsley is also a great source of vitamins A and C — important nutrients with antioxidant
properties
 Parsley is widely used as a fresh culinary herb or dried spice.
 Parsley contains plant compounds that may have anticancer effects.
 The main antioxidants in parsley are flavonoids, carotenoids, and vitamin C.
